]> git.ipfire.org Git - thirdparty/sqlite.git/commitdiff
:-) (CVS 68)
authordrh <drh@noemail.net>
Wed, 7 Jun 2000 02:04:22 +0000 (02:04 +0000)
committerdrh <drh@noemail.net>
Wed, 7 Jun 2000 02:04:22 +0000 (02:04 +0000)
FossilOrigin-Name: fc8d25ea1fffa115fad15b9eb8bb0b0aaaff0431

manifest
manifest.uuid
src/shell.c
src/tokenize.c

index c17a49ba94931ceb5c2a984429a2524db3f81f36..3d721383629e0e86781de05802e23c1fbece2f6d 100644 (file)
--- a/manifest
+++ b/manifest
@@ -1,5 +1,5 @@
-C :-)\s(CVS\s67)
-D 2000-06-07T01:33:42
+C :-)\s(CVS\s68)
+D 2000-06-07T02:04:23
 F COPYRIGHT 74a8a6531a42e124df07ab5599aad63870fa0bd4
 F Makefile.in 17ba1ccf8d2d40c627796bba8f72952365d6d644
 F README 51f6a4e7408b34afa5bc1c0485f61b6a4efb6958
@@ -15,11 +15,11 @@ F src/insert.c 5e69dd70c3f91cf5ec5090f39fd6cd8e135af9bf
 F src/main.c 93a7ad14bb5a82ad13ad59da23ef674a94b0c3d6
 F src/parse.y 8b632f4c4ff2f4400f15592ca9d8fda27d97d0c4
 F src/select.c 74fa3af62bfa2e6e29f43153f883fd28c295b853
-F src/shell.c 9c9813926fa125c226d4bec464c9b9fdd6bf78f7
+F src/shell.c 3f4afc39a36e4824e8aa262623fd03568874799e
 F src/sqlite.h 58da0a8590133777b741f9836beaef3d58f40268
 F src/sqliteInt.h 3cca846df0a8b5f811cf4f8021303547cd8f21fd
 F src/tclsqlite.c 9f358618ae803bedf4fb96da5154fd45023bc1f7
-F src/tokenize.c 09373590cc3942aa4744eb431ac5b5ce31e7cfea
+F src/tokenize.c 900af9479d0feaa76b0225680196aa81afec930a
 F src/update.c 18746f920f989b3d19d96c08263c92584823cd35
 F src/util.c 33f9baa01e45394ef0cf85361a0e872987884315
 F src/vdbe.c d2ac31f6c0bb967b47409e715872992dd2fa62d3
@@ -51,7 +51,7 @@ F www/c_interface.tcl 9ac800854272db5fe439e07b7435b243a5422293
 F www/changes.tcl 04e66b4257589ff78a7e1de93e9dda4725fb03d6
 F www/index.tcl 52e29a4eeda8d59e91af43c61fef177c5f2ffd53
 F www/sqlite.tcl 2f933ce18cffd34a0a020a82435ab937137970fd
-P 5d2e72e4bd5e218133190b8b1ebe52f48e2d7140
-R 1384c304cdabddd80130851d4edee697
+P 8bff1bee63b77353b4cfe5aa0c662187a7bf93da
+R 66723773907deae85c622c6e494a06db
 U drh
-Z 007e2024f795b53d937e0ac66c9776f0
+Z 03e9a47b962f6283d6dab7f071f9c9ae
index 7f56c3d1840722a923e0ce5bc6e83449bba7f7f4..87b75f85141040a54f3b9833d09321962836fd55 100644 (file)
@@ -1 +1 @@
-8bff1bee63b77353b4cfe5aa0c662187a7bf93da
\ No newline at end of file
+fc8d25ea1fffa115fad15b9eb8bb0b0aaaff0431
\ No newline at end of file
index 0a0a975ca8cc94f3feb4f3f5085270b45c177729..da0f1e69bfb18a12dbc9a657b31450154b6c7a53 100644 (file)
@@ -24,7 +24,7 @@
 ** This file contains code to implement the "sqlite" command line
 ** utility for accessing SQLite databases.
 **
-** $Id: shell.c,v 1.11 2000/06/07 01:33:42 drh Exp $
+** $Id: shell.c,v 1.12 2000/06/07 02:04:23 drh Exp $
 */
 #include <stdlib.h>
 #include <string.h>
@@ -212,7 +212,7 @@ static int callback(void *pArg, int nArg, char **azArg, char **azCol){
           }
           if( z[j] ){
             fprintf(p->out, "\\%c", z[j]);
-            z = &z[j+1];
+            z++;
           }
           z += j;
         }
@@ -256,6 +256,7 @@ static int dump_callback(void *pArg, int nArg, char **azArg, char **azCol){
     char zSql[1000];
     d2 = *pData;
     d2.mode = MODE_List;
+    d2.escape = '\t';
     strcpy(d2.separator,"\t");
     fprintf(pData->out, "COPY '%s' FROM STDIN;\n", azArg[0]);
     sprintf(zSql, "SELECT * FROM '%s'", azArg[0]);
index f750debe13cd65b5d87b1179638b9a84b96026df..ef2726a4f5294d46811a1e1b10b45278c24f5e3d 100644 (file)
@@ -27,7 +27,7 @@
 ** individual tokens and sends those tokens one-by-one over to the
 ** parser for analysis.
 **
-** $Id: tokenize.c,v 1.8 2000/06/06 21:56:08 drh Exp $
+** $Id: tokenize.c,v 1.9 2000/06/07 02:04:23 drh Exp $
 */
 #include "sqliteInt.h"
 #include <ctype.h>
@@ -337,7 +337,7 @@ int sqliteRunParser(Parse *pParse, char *zSql, char **pzErrMsg){
           sqliteParserTrace(trace, "parser: ");
         }else if( sqliteStrNICmp(z,"--vdbe-trace-on--",17)==0 ){
           pParse->db->flags |= SQLITE_VdbeTrace;
-        }else if( sqliteStrNICmp(z,"--vdbe-trace-off--", 19)==0 ){
+        }else if( sqliteStrNICmp(z,"--vdbe-trace-off--", 18)==0 ){
           pParse->db->flags &= ~SQLITE_VdbeTrace;
         }
         break;